Common Warning Lights and Interpretations



Identify typical warning lights in your automobile and understand their meanings to make sure risk-free driving.

The most normal warning lights include the check engine light, which signals problems with the engine or discharges system. If this light begins, it's essential to have your automobile inspected quickly.

A flashing battery light might suggest a damaged billing system, possibly leaving you stranded otherwise addressed.

The tire stress surveillance system (TPMS) light signals you to low tire pressure, influencing car security and gas efficiency. Ignoring this could bring about harmful driving conditions.

Lastly, the coolant temperature warning light warns of engine overheating, which can result in severe damage if not settled swiftly.

Comprehending these typical warning lights will certainly help you deal with issues quickly and preserve risk-free driving conditions.

In some cases the issue can be as simple as a loosened gas cap triggering the check engine light. Tightening up the gas cap may deal with the trouble.

One more usual concern is a low battery, which can set off various cautioning lights. Inspecting the battery links for rust and ensuring they're safe could repair the trouble.



If a caution light continues, you can attempt resetting it by separating the cars and truck's battery for a few mins and afterwards reconnecting it. In addition, inspecting your lorry's fluid degrees, such as oil, coolant, and brake liquid, can assist troubleshoot warning lights associated with these systems.
